Why Pests Love the Start of the Year

Cooler temperatures, extra clutter from the holidays, and more time spent indoors create the perfect storm for pests. Rodents search for warmth, spiders follow their prey indoors, and cockroaches thrive in kitchens with food scraps and cardboard boxes. Even though you might not see much activity right now, pests are quietly finding ways to make themselves comfortable.

Resolution #1: Seal Entry Points Early

Tiny cracks in foundations or gaps under doors are all it takes for mice, ants, and other insects to move in. Walk the perimeter of your home, check weather stripping, and seal around utility lines and vents. A little prevention now saves you a lot of frustration later.

Resolution #2: Clean and Declutter

After the holidays, garages and attics often become storage zones for cardboard boxes, decorations, and old linens—all perfect nesting spots for rodents and silverfish. Replace cardboard with plastic bins, vacuum baseboards, and keep storage areas dry and well-ventilated.

Resolution #3: Manage Moisture and Food Sources

Leaky faucets, damp basements, and leftover crumbs are like open invitations to pests. Check for moisture buildup, empty pet bowls overnight, and store pantry goods in airtight containers.

Resolution #4: Schedule Preventive Pest Control

Even with great habits, it’s easy to miss what’s hiding behind walls or under insulation. Regular inspections from a licensed professional can identify problems before they grow. According to the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A), integrated pest management—focusing on prevention and monitoring—offers the most effective long-term protection.
